Automotive Smart Surface Industry Review 2024 – AutoTech News
Product Details:
Automotive smart surfaces integrated with various interior materials, providing touch control, lighting, and temperature functions.
Technical Parameters:
– Capacitive touch technology for high sensitivity and rapid response.
– Haptic feedback devices for tactile response during operation.
– Micro LED or OLED technology for intuitive graphical interface.
– Integration of multiple functions into a compact module.
Application Scenarios:
– Center console for air conditioning and information display.
– Door panels for door lock and window control.
– Steering wheel for volume adjustment and driving mode switching.
– NEXUS door panel concept with heating and electronic rearview mirror functions.
Pros:
– Enhanced user experience with touch interaction and haptic feedback.
– Reduction of physical buttons leading to a cleaner cockpit design.
– Integration of multiple functions into fewer components, optimizing space
– Futuristic aesthetic appeal and advanced technology integration.
Cons:
– Current penetration rate of smart surfaces is still below 5%.
– High production costs associated with materials and processes.
– Challenges in developing new smart surface materials.
– Potential for false triggers if not properly designed.

Frequently Asked Questions (FAQs)
What should I look for in a smart surface manufacturing company?
When choosing a smart surface manufacturer, consider their experience in automotive applications, technology capabilities, and material options. Look for companies that prioritize innovation, have a strong quality control process, and can provide customization to meet your specific needs. Additionally, check their certifications and customer reviews to ensure reliability.
How can I evaluate the quality of smart surfaces?
To evaluate quality, request samples of their smart surfaces and assess their durability, finish, and functionality. Inquire about their testing methods and certifications. It’s also helpful to ask for references from other automotive manufacturers who have used their products to get firsthand feedback on performance and reliability.
What is the typical lead time for smart surface manufacturing?
Lead times can vary based on complexity and order size, but generally, you can expect anywhere from a few weeks to several months. Always discuss timelines upfront and consider the manufacturer’s capacity to meet your production schedule, especially if you have tight deadlines.
Are there specific technologies I should look for in smart surfaces?
Yes, look for technologies like touch-sensitive interfaces, integrated lighting, and advanced materials that offer both aesthetics and functionality. Additionally, features such as self-cleaning surfaces or antimicrobial properties can add value and enhance user experience in car interiors.
How do I ensure the supplier can meet regulatory standards?
Ask potential suppliers about their compliance with industry regulations and standards, such as ISO certifications and automotive industry requirements. Request documentation that verifies their adherence to safety and environmental guidelines, and ensure they have a robust quality assurance process in place.
